Most of the work was in the front of the stove, with the exception of running the wired thermostat to the back of the stove and into the stove itself. This required pulling the stove away from the wall. I used moving pads used for furniture and placed them under the front feet of the stove. At that point I was easily able to slide the stove out. I unscrewed and slid down the back panel and that allowed me to feed the wire thermostat into the oven and mount it to the clip on brackets. In the front, I just removed the wires from the original thermostat, one at a time, and plugged them back into the new thermostat.
